## Build Provenance: Flagwright Rollout Framework

Every Flagwright release is built by the Hatchrow pipeline, which signs artifacts before they reach the staged-rollout controller. If you're on call and a flag gate misbehaves, confirm the running binary matches the signed manifest before escalating to the Platform Guild. The provenance record for the current production build is reproduced below.

pipeline stamp: htk9_6ce9d33c5

Facilities Ticket — Cleaning Crew Access, Brindle Annex

For new starters handling evening lock-up: the Sorano Cleaning crew arrives nightly at 21:30 via the annex side door. Check their rota sheet, note arrival in the log, and ensure the storeroom is relocked afterward. To let them through the side door, enter the access code below.

badge for yaweg-hafog: bdg-GX-6

## Deploying the Gatewick Proctor Queue

Deploys are pretty painless: push to main, wait for the pipeline, then watch the queue drain dashboard for five minutes. If candidates pile up mid-exam, roll back first and ask questions later — the queue replays safely. Everything the workers care about lives in one config block, shown here for reference.

settings of bafof-yagef:
JOROX_PIN=8740
JOROX_TENANT=pelox
JOROX_METRICS_HOST=metrics.jorox.qorvelworks.internal
JOROX_SEAL=seal_c78f63c1
JOROX_STANDBY_TEAM=norax

## Break-Glass Access — Flagwheel Rollout Framework

If Flagwheel's control plane goes dark and you need to force-disable a rollout, use the break-glass console on the admin node. Yes, it's clunky; no, we haven't fixed it. The console prompts for the emergency recovery passphrase before it'll accept any kill commands.

strongbox words: gilok-druion-briath-wendor-briion-prawyn-fenion-oliir-casdor-holius-briius-gilath-gilael-pelys